Understanding the Power Consumption of the RTX 4090

The Nvidia RTX 4090 is designed with cutting-edge technology to deliver exceptional gaming performance. Its power consumption varies depending on the workload, but during intense gaming sessions, it can draw significant power. The typical power draw of the RTX 4090 ranges from 450 to 600 watts under full load, depending on the specific model and system configuration.

Estimating Electricity Costs During Gaming

To estimate the electricity costs of running an RTX 4090 during intense gaming, consider the following calculation:

Power consumption (in kilowatt-hours) = Power draw (in watts) × Duration (hours) ÷ 1000

For example, if the GPU consumes 600 watts during a 3-hour gaming session:

600 W × 3 hours ÷ 1000 = 1.8 kWh

Assuming an average electricity rate of $0.13 per kWh, the cost would be:

1.8 kWh × $0.13 = $0.234

Strategies to Reduce Power Consumption

  • Lower Graphics Settings: Reducing resolution and graphics quality can decrease power usage.
  • Enable Power Saving Modes: Use GPU power management features to optimize energy efficiency.
  • Optimize System Cooling: Efficient cooling can help maintain performance without excessive power draw.
  • Limit Gaming Duration: Taking breaks reduces total energy consumption over time.
